In our fast-paced lives, it’s easy to become overwhelmed by the uncertainties of tomorrow. The weight of future worries can steal our peace and distract us from the joys of today. Thankfully, the Bible offers timeless wisdom and encouragement for those who struggle with anxiety about what lies ahead.

Exploring these 30 Bible verses can provide comfort and guidance, reminding us to place our trust in God’s plan rather than being consumed by uncertainty. Each verse serves as a reminder that we are not alone in our concerns, and that faith can be our anchor amid life’s storms.

 Therefore do not worry about tomorrow, for tomorrow will worry about itself. Each day has enough trouble of its own.   - Matthew 6:34

Finding Peace in God’s Promises

Dear Lord,

In moments of uncertainty, my heart feels heavy with worries about tomorrow. I come before You, seeking solace in Your words and the assurance of Your love. Remind me that each day has enough trouble of its own, and guide me to trust in Your provision and plans for my life.

Help me to release my anxieties into Your capable hands. Grant me the wisdom to live in the present, cherishing the blessings You provide daily. Fill my heart with peace that surpasses all understanding, reassuring me that You hold my future.

May Your light shine brightly in my worries, dispelling fears and doubts. Teach me to seek first Your kingdom and righteousness, knowing that all my needs will be met. Let me find hope and strength through prayer, casting my concerns upon You.

Thank You for being my constant source of comfort and for Your promise to never leave or forsake me. As I release my worries about tomorrow, may I be filled with faith, joy, and the assurance that You are already there, preparing the path ahead.

In Jesus’ name, I pray, Amen.
